Unequal tire pressure can cause your mower to pull to one side. Check tire pressures and keep them filled to the manufacturer’s spec. Tires on each side of your mower require equal pressure. Bad dampers on zero turn. Bad dampers will cause your mower to jerk to one side when moving forward. Replace with a new damper.

A lawn mower may overheat due to a low engine oil level, the wrong type of engine oil, plugged cooling fins, a clogged air filter, a damaged engine guard, a plugged mower deck, dull mower blades, or overworking the engine. Your lawn mower won't have enough power to turn over when the battery is dead or has a low charge. Start with checking the battery's charge with a voltmeter. A fully charged 12-volt battery should give you a reading of about 12.7 volts.When a lawn mower gets too hot, it can shut off as a safety measure to prevent any damage or harm. Testing the carb solenoid is easy, just turn on the key & listen near carb for a click that would be the solenoid opening the plug to main jet. Then turning key off should have an audible click as well. But you would resally need to be close & listen hard.

Regularly clean or replace the air filter according to the manufacturer's recommendations. 1. Bad, Old, or Wrong Fuel. Running good fresh fuel through your riding mower is best. Gasoline can begin to break down and become less effective as soon as 30 days after purchase. Ethanol in your gasoline along with the moisture it attracts can gum up the fuel system causing clogs. When this happens, your lawn mower starts then dies. Other reasons for blue or white smoke from engines include: Exceeding the engine's oil capacity shown on dipstick. If so, a battery ...Solution: Replace a fuel filter by shutting off the fuel supply using the fuel shut-off valve on the mower. If there isn’t a valve on your mower, use pinch pliers to crimp the fuel line to stop the flow. Remove the filter from the fuel lines. Install a new filter paying attention to the arrow located on the filter.

The reason your mower shuts off when you start to engage the mower is that a wire under the mower some where has had the insulation rubbed off and either the lever or the linkage contacts the bare wire and grounds out the engine. 13. Bad Gas Cap. Your Poulan Pro fuel cap has a vent that allows air to pass through the cap. When this vent is plugged, the mower will die after it starts. A clogged vent will cause the fuel tank to form a vacuum restricting fuel.
